What are the implications of a high put to call ratio in the cryptocurrency market?

What does it mean when the put to call ratio is high in the cryptocurrency market? How does this ratio affect the market dynamics and investor sentiment?

- Diwakar SinghOct 13, 2020 · 5 years agoA high put to call ratio in the cryptocurrency market can have several implications. Firstly, it suggests that there is a higher level of uncertainty and fear among investors, which can lead to increased volatility in prices. Secondly, it indicates that there is a greater demand for downside protection, as investors are buying more put options. This can result in increased selling pressure and downward price movements. Lastly, a high put to call ratio can also reflect a shift in market sentiment towards a bearish outlook, as investors anticipate a potential decline in cryptocurrency prices. It is important for investors to closely monitor the put to call ratio and consider it alongside other market indicators when making trading decisions.
